I have delinquent property taxes, who do I pay them to?
If the taxes are for property in the City of Fulton you will pay them to the Fulton City Chamberlain.
If they are for property anywhere else in the County of Oswego you will pay them to the County Treasurer.

I received my bill and it's missing an exemption, who do I contact about this?
If you believe it's an exemption that you applied for on time and that you are entitled to, you would need to contact your local assessor to find out why it wasn't granted or if there was an error.
Please note however that only exemptions that affect that bill will appear on the bill, so exemptions that affect county/town taxes will not appear on the school tax bill and vice versa.
How do I sell or transfer my property to someone else?
A common misconception about transferring title to real property is that it's similar to transferring title to a car - it isn't. In New York State, real property can only be transferred via will or deed and the full process is more complex than most people realize. We highly recommend contacting a lawyer who can advise you on the different steps you would need to take, as no County agency or department is able to do so.
Do you have a copy of my survey?
If your survey was filed with the County, it would be filed with the County Clerk. However, unless you personally filed your survey or have knowledge that it was filed, it very likely wasn't. Many people assume that their surveyor or attorney filed the survey on their behalf, but unless it was part of a subdivision there is no legal requirement that they do so.
